#9785CA Hex Color Code

#9785CA

The Hexadecimal Color #9785CA is a contrast shade of Medium Purple. #9785CA RGB value is rgb(151, 133, 202). RGB Color Model of #9785CA consists of 59% red, 52% green and 79% blue. HSL color Mode of #9785CA has 256°(degrees) Hue, 39% Saturation and 66% Lightness. #9785CA color has an wavelength of 458.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#9785CA is #9999C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#9785CA is #98C. The Closest Color to #9785CA is #9370DB. Official Name of #9785CA Hex Code is Blue Bell.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#9785CA is 25 Cyan 34 Magenta 0 Yellow 21 Black and #9785CA CMY is 25, 34,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#9785CA is hsl(256,39,66,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(256, 34, 79).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#9785CA is 31.81, 27.62, 59.52.
Hex8 Value of #9785CA is #9785CAFF. Decimal Value of #9785CA is 9930186 and Octal Value of #9785CA is 45702712. Binary Value of #9785CA is 10010111, 10000101, 11001010 and Android of #9785CA is 4288120266 / 0xff9785ca.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#9785CA is 0.267, 0.232, 0.232 and YIQ Color Space of #9785CA is 146.248, -11.4435, 25.2798.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#9785CA is 25.51, 24.87, 59.0.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#9785CA is 59.54, 21.53, -33.28.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#9785CA is 59.54, 4.53, -54.5.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#9785CA is 59.54, 39.64, 302.9. Hunter Lab variable of #9785CA is 52.55, 16.07, -30.36.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#9785CA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
